Snowman and layers were cut at 3.75" high.
There is a layer that looks like cute little buttons, but I decided to use real buttons instead.
Looking at it now I wish I had stamped a little checked background on the scraft and/or ran it through the Cuttlebug for some texture. Oh well, next time!
I still think he looks Super Cool though and
"Warm Winter Wishes" is the perfect sentiment from him!

Recipe:
Card Base: SU Blue Bayou 4 1/4" X 5 1/2" (folded)
Card front: Soft Sky 4" X 5 1/4"
Other Cardstock / Paper: SU Real Red, black, white
Ink: Real Red
Stamps: PTI Stocking Prints (sentiment)
Accessories: SU Oval punches, Buttons, needle and thread, Gypsy & Smiley Cards download, Cricut, Cuttlebug & Snowflakes embossing folder, SU Ribbon Originals "District"
